Review: A Beautiful, Design-Led Oasis in Fisherman’s Village We recently stayed at the Hansar Samui, and it is truly a beautiful property with a thoughtful design. The location is perfect—just a short, pleasant stroll away from Fisherman’s Village, making it easy to explore the local area while still feeling like you have a quiet retreat to return to. The Highlights Dining Experience: The breakfast was a standout. I particularly appreciated having eggs made fresh to order; there is nothing worse than pre-cooked, rubbery eggs left under heat lamps, so this was a huge bonus for me. The Vibe: The swimming pool is lovely, and the beach is kept very clean. The hotel maintains a relaxed atmosphere, complemented by a great selection of background music. Service & Little Touches: The staff were incredibly welcoming and kind. I loved the ”turn-down” service around 5:00 PM, where housekeeping brought little chocolates and water—an adorable touch that made us feel looked after. Facilities: The gym is clean and well-maintained. Crucially for those working remotely, the Wi-Fi was excellent and reliable enough for me to take Zoom meetings without any issues. Room Design: The rooms are beautifully decorated with stunning balconies and views. The bathroom was a highlight, especially the large rainfall shower. Room Comfort & Maintenance We did have a significant issue with the bed. The mattresses are very soft, which didn't suit us at all as my husband has a bad back. It made sleeping quite difficult. However, the staff were wonderful and tried their best to accommodate us; they helped remove the mattress so we could sleep on the wooden base with just the mattress topper. While not ”luxury” comfort, it was much better for his back than the soft mattress. We also had a few issues with a temperamental toilet flush, but to the hotel's credit, maintenance was very prompt in coming to fix it each time. Dining & Logistics We had dinner at the restaurant one evening, ordering the Massaman curry and Chicken Panang. While the food was edible, it was just ”okay”—we were perhaps expecting a bit more given how high the quality of breakfast was. That said, the view from the restaurant in the evening is spectacular, and they occasionally have lovely entertainment. One small hiccup occurred when we booked a taxi through the hotel to take us to the pier for our trip to Koh Phangan. The driver unfortunately dropped us at the wrong port. We had to quickly catch a Grab to the correct one, but luckily we made it just in time for our ferry. Overall Despite a few minor glitches, this was a wonderful stay. The aesthetic of the hotel is gorgeous, and the professionalism of the staff ensures that any issues are handled quickly. I would definitely recommend Hansar for anyone looking for a stylish and relaxed stay in Samui!

The hotel is quite old, but it has beautiful grounds and lush, tropical plants. The breakfasts are decent, the pools are clean, and the staff is attentive. The squirrels near the restaurant are adorable! The sea and beach are simply stunning, and there were always enough sun loungers. The plumbing in the room was fine. Now for the downsides: The sun loungers and their mattresses are very old. The bed linen also looks quite worn. The room is a bit dark, and the air conditioning blows directly onto the beds, making it impossible to sleep with it on. The dishes in the restaurant are also dated, which was unpleasant. There's also not enough lighting in the evenings, even on the hotel grounds. On my last day, it rained, and I slipped and fell on the tiles; luckily, I didn't break anything. We stayed in room A06, which had direct pool access. However, even in these rooms, which are the furthest from the bar, you can still hear noise from the neighboring bar at night. If you're a light sleeper, this might be uncomfortable. The planes weren't really an issue; they don't fly by that often. I'd like to address parents separately: unsupervised children in the pool were behaving terribly – screaming, teasing, and swearing – all right outside our rooms. Their parents paid no attention, making it impossible to relax in our room or on the terrace. Overall, though, I recommend the hotel because of its location and proximity to the sea.

Our expectations were high and in the beginning it really seemed to be living up to them. First of all the staff is incredible - polite, smiling and helpful. The management was thoughtful and caring and the cleanliness was of the highest standard. When trying to use the pool during the day you will find it's impossible. Thai heat simply makes it unbearable and there's absolutely no cover from the sun - in my opinion poor design of the pool area that should have been considered during construction. Another thing is ordering a cocktail by the pool you get it in a plastic cup for water with decoration being a single piece of pineapple. Even the cheapest bars I used to visit would try harder to decorate the cocktail and in my opinion for the price we paid here it definitely shouldn't be served like this. Just seems like low value for money - same goes for the restaurant: We were told there was a barbecue event at the beach but actually it was only the normal menu of the restaurant just like every other day - price is simply too high for the presentation of the food which was just average. Breakfast was also underwhelming and a huge issue for me was the taste of the coffee! I don't know if it's due to desalinated sea water used as drinking water but americano had a horrible salty taste that was impossible to drink. In my opinion bottleded water must be used for the espresso machine because as such it is undrinkable. Finally the location of the resort itself isn't the best, the beach is tiny and rocky and to get anywhere you need to be driven in a buggy which you need to book and then wait. Many times I've witnessed peaople frustrated and give up on waiting for it and walk instead, as we done a few times also. Unfortunately overall I wouldn't plan on returning again even though the staff is exceptional.

Beautiful looking hotel, quiet and relaxed but also just a short scooter ride away from Fisherman’s village. For everyone confused about the beach situation: there is a long bit of beach by the hotel. The hotel itseld doesn’t have beds on the beach itself, however, the beds are just above and around the pool area that overlooks the beach. If you wanna lay on the beach, in the morning there is high tide so you won’t be having much sand to lay on, still good for a swim. In the afternoon/evening there is low tide so you can put your towel down easily.
